  3. I had one 20 years ago and I had two about two years ago. It was like night and day. Years ago it was a multi-visit ordeal and they removed the roots with an object that was like a metal straw. There was a reason for all the jokes about it. Now, it is all in one sitting, they take x-rays every 5 minutes to make sure they are not missing anything. I've had more painful trips to the regular dentist. One note- sometimes after a root canal your tooth gets very brittle. There is a chance it cold crack after the proceedure. Ask your doc about it. I personally like to go with a filling for a while and then the cap. Although if I remember right the cap can take about 10 times the biting pressure a filling can. So there is a little risk either way. Again ask the doc. BTW, it was a good decision on the flex spending. It makes the wallet hit a little less painfull.
